Physician Assistant Salary in Lansing, MI: $132,487 (2026)
Quick Answer:A full-time physician assistant in Lansing, MI earns a median $132,487/year (≈ $63.70/hour) in nominal terms for 2026 — projected from BLS OEWS 2025 (SOC 29-1071). Once you factor in Lansing's price level (5% below national, BEA RPP 95.0), that paycheck buys what $139,473 would nationally. Nominal pay sits 1.8% below the Michigan state average.

Salary Trajectory for Physician Assistants in Lansing (2019–2027)
2019–2025: actual BLS OEWS data for this metro area. 2026+: CAGR 3.32% projection.
| Year | Annual Salary | Status |
|---|---|---|
| 2019 | $111,550 | Actual |
| 2020 | $117,170 | Actual |
| 2021 | $121,010 | Actual |
| 2022 | $124,220 | Actual |
| 2023 | $130,730 | Actual |
| 2024 | $130,410 | Actual |
| 2025 | $128,230 | Actual |
| 2026(current) | $132,487 | Estimated |
| 2027 | $136,886 | Projected |
Based on 7 years of BLS OEWS data for the Lansing metropolitan area, the median physician assistant salary grew 15.0% from $111,550 (2019) to $128,230 (2025). At a 3.32% compound annual growth rate, salaries are projected to reach $136,886 by 2027 — a total increase of $25,336 (22.71%) from 2019.
Note: Historical values (2019–2025) are actual BLS OEWS figures for the Lansing metropolitan area, sourced from annual Occupational Employment and Wage Statistics surveys. 2026–2026 figures are current estimates, and 2027 values are projections, calculated using a 3.32% CAGR derived from 7-year BLS historical data. Physician Assistant Job Market in Lansing
Lansing supports approximately 260 physician assistants, validating a steady demand for this profession in the area. The cost of living index stands at 94.991, which is below the national average, potentially enhancing the purchasing power of salaries earned locally. Hospitals and surgical specialty practices—particularly in orthopedics and cardiothoracic surgery—tend to offer the most lucrative positions, often higher than other facilities like urgent care centers or primary care offices. The variability in compensation can be attributed to factors such as specialization, case volume, and underlying structural differences in employment settings, where hospital employees generally receive more stability and benefits than locum tenens, or 1099 arrangements. For those seeking to maximize their pay in Lansing, pursuing a specialty in surgery, negotiating for RVU productivity bonuses, and focusing on first-assist opportunities in high-demand areas can be effective strategies.
